Controls and Features

Read this owner's manual before operating your winch. Familiarize yourself with the location and
function of the controls and features. Save this manual for future reference.

Winch

6
1
Motor (1):
1.3
HP 12V DC motor provides
power to the planetary gear mechanism.
Winch Drum (2): The winch drum is the
cylinder on which the wire rope is stored. It
can feed or wind the rope depending on the
remote winch switch.
Wire Rope (3): 3/16" x 45.9' galvanized
aircraft cable designed specifically for load
capacity of 3,00lbs. (44 useable feet with five
wraps on the drum). The wire rope feeds
onto the drum in the "under wind" position
through the roller fairlead (4) and is looped
at the end to accept the clevis hook pin (12).
Roller Fairlead (4): When using the
winch at an angle the roller fairlead acts to
guide the wire rope onto the drum and
minimizes damage to the wire rope from
abrasion on the winch mount or bumper.
Free spooling Clutch (5): The clutch
allows the operator to manually disengage
("FREESPOOL") the spooling drum from
the gear train. Engaging the clutch
("ENGAGE") locks the winch into the gear
system.
Braking System (6): Braking action is
automatically applied to the winch drum

when the winch motor is stopped and there
is a load on the wire rope.
Planetary Gear System (7): The
reduction gears convert the winch motor
power into extreme pulling forces. This
system allows high torque while maintaining
compact size and light weight.
Rocker Switch (8): Rocker switch with
handlebar mount for powering the rope in or
out of your winch drum.
Hand Held Switch (9): Hand held switch
with a remote socket for powering the rope
in or out of your winch drum.
Fairlead Mount (10): Adapter to mount
the winch and fairlead for utility
applications.
Contactor (11): Power from the vehicle
battery flows through the weather sealed
solenoid switch before being directed to the
winch motor.
Clevis Hook (12): Provides a means for
connecting the looped ends of cables to an
anchor.
